This place is absolutely abysmal. Natalie is by far the worst landlord I’ve ever had. In the 3 years I lived there I never met the woman. She did a pre-move out inspection and had knocked down several of the vertical blinds on the sliding door. She also left both the sliding door and hallway door unlocked when I still had personal items in the unit. We lived on the first floor so anyone could just walk in after her walkthrough. Not to mention the absolutely terrible snow removal. They never salted the parking lot making it an ice rink. There are several elderly residents and this is just downright dangerous. This complex and the landlord are lazy and unconcerned with the safety of their tenants

I'm going to add to these poor reviews. I did like the apartment I thought that was nice, but Natalie is by far the worst manager. I have never seen/met her, she doesn't answer her phone, and takes days to answer a single text message. I didn't even see her for moveout. When it came to move out... they charged me $100 to fix the 14 nail holes in my walls. No where on the move out sheet did it say they would charge. They charged $120 for carpet cleaning (which is standard for charging), and pre-charged me $70 for a 2 hour cleaning fee -- when they didn't even clean yet. This is after I spent 5 hours cleaning myself. And I've never been charged on a previous apartment for cleaning before.
